The STM32L452RET6 belongs to the category of microcontrollers.
It is primarily used for embedded systems and applications that require low power consumption.
The STM32L452RET6 comes in a small package, specifically the LQFP64 package.
This microcontroller is designed to provide efficient processing capabilities while minimizing power consumption.
The STM32L452RET6 is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.
The STM32L452RET6 has a total of 64 pins. The pin configuration is as follows:
The STM32L452RET6 operates based on the ARM Cortex-M4 core architecture. It executes instructions stored in its flash memory, interacts with peripherals through various communication interfaces, and manages power consumption using different low-power modes.
The STM32L452RET6 is suitable for a wide range of applications, including but not limited to: - Internet of Things (IoT) devices - Wearable technology - Home automation systems - Industrial control systems - Medical devices
While the STM32L452RET6 offers unique features, there are alternative microcontrollers available with similar capabilities. Some notable alternatives include: - STM32L476RET6 - STM32F407VGT6 - Atmel SAMD21G18A
These alternative models provide comparable performance and features, allowing developers to choose the most suitable microcontroller for their specific application.
Word count: 511 words
Sure! Here are 10 common questions and answers related to the application of STM32L452RET6 in technical solutions:
Q: What is the STM32L452RET6 microcontroller used for? A: The STM32L452RET6 is a low-power microcontroller commonly used in battery-powered applications, IoT devices, and other energy-efficient solutions.
Q: What is the maximum clock frequency of the STM32L452RET6? A: The STM32L452RET6 can operate at a maximum clock frequency of 80 MHz.
Q: How much flash memory does the STM32L452RET6 have? A: The STM32L452RET6 has 512 KB of flash memory for storing program code and data.
Q: Can I use the STM32L452RET6 for analog signal processing? A: Yes, the STM32L452RET6 has built-in analog peripherals such as ADCs, DACs, and comparators, making it suitable for analog signal processing applications.
Q: Does the STM32L452RET6 support communication protocols like UART, SPI, and I2C? A: Yes, the STM32L452RET6 supports various communication protocols including UART, SPI, I2C, and CAN.
Q: What is the operating voltage range of the STM32L452RET6? A: The STM32L452RET6 operates from a supply voltage range of 1.71V to 3.6V.
Q: Can I use the STM32L452RET6 in industrial environments? A: Yes, the STM32L452RET6 is designed to withstand harsh industrial environments and has features like temperature sensors and watchdog timers for reliable operation.
Q: Does the STM32L452RET6 have a real-time clock (RTC) module? A: Yes, the STM32L452RET6 has an integrated RTC module that can be used for timekeeping and scheduling applications.
Q: Can I program the STM32L452RET6 using C/C++? A: Yes, the STM32L452RET6 can be programmed using C/C++ programming languages with the help of development tools like STM32CubeIDE or Keil MDK.
Q: Are there any development boards available for the STM32L452RET6? A: Yes, STMicroelectronics provides development boards like Nucleo-64 and Discovery kits that are compatible with the STM32L452RET6 microcontroller.
Please note that these answers are general and may vary depending on specific requirements and configurations.